    Abstract: An intelligent method of mutual validation between a cluster manager and a new node, also enabling automatic signing of an application certificate for the new node. A root certificate authority is embedded in a cluster manager at the factory. The certificate includes the cluster manager serial number. Similarly, a certificate is embedded in an appliance to be joined as a new node, the certificate including the appliance's serial number. When requesting to join the cluster, the node sends its certificate to the cluster manager. The cluster manager verifies that the serial number in the certificate matches a serial number in its white list and validates the certificate ownership by the node. Conversely, the cluster manager sends its certificate to the node, so that the node can verify its communicating with a valid cluster manager. The node can then ask the manager to sign its application certificate, and the manager uses its root certificate authority to sign the certificate.

    Abstract: In general, in one aspect, the invention relates to a method for managing nodes in a cluster. The method includes obtaining metadata from controllers on a node, processing the metadata to obtain solution groups and a processing sequence of the solution groups, notifying a solution manager to initiate performance of pre-update tasks associated with the node, and performing, after the notifying, an update of the nodes in the cluster based on the processing sequence of the solution groups.

    Abstract: A system for processor configuration comprising a processor that includes a plurality of algorithmic controls stored in memory and configured to cause the processor to perform predetermined functions. A remote access controller coupled to the processor and configured to communicate over a communications medium and to send and receive controls and data to a remote device. Wherein the remote access controller is further configured to detect one or more server groups over the communications medium and to generate a prompt on a user interface device of the remote access controller to allow a user to select a control for the processor to be configured to join one of the server groups when the processor transitions from a power off state to a power on state.

    Abstract: A cluster management system sends a first message over a communications network to detect a server node which runs a base operating system image configured to communicate with the cluster management system to enable discovery and network configuration of the server node. In response to receiving the first message, the base operating system image sends a second message to the cluster management system, wherein the second message includes node identifying information associated with the server node. The cluster management system and the base operating system image communicate to configure network settings of the server node based on server cluster specifications and the node identifying information. Subsequent to completion of the network configuration, the cluster management system automatically provisions the server node for inclusion in a server cluster by re-imaging the server node with a server operating system to enable operation of the server node in the server cluster.
